Dump fire helps leave dark cloud over "ambitious targets" to reduce Shire landfill

A new report about Douglas Shire waste disposal “sets ambitious targets for reducing landfill”, but shows landfill being generated from household waste may have actually increased across the past decade, including a steep rise this year following a fire at a dump in Cairns.

Jungle Fowl in elite company after national accolade

Thai restaurant Jungle Fowl has been named in the Gourmet Traveller top 100 restaurants in Australia for the second time in three years.
